The hexadecimal color code #106DE3 corresponds to the code RGB( 16, 109, 227 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,06 level), green (at 0,43 level) and blue (at 0,89 level). Its brightness is 47% and its saturation is 86%. It is composed of red at 4%, green at 30% and blue at 64%. The dominant component is blue.
